このアプリケーションについて

Nixwriter is a utility designed for Linux operating systems to help users create bootable Linux images on removable storage media. It provides a straightforward interface for selecting a target storage device and writing an operating system ISO or image file directly to the drive. The application focuses specifically on this singular flashing task without incorporating extraneous partition management or disk formatting suites. Users rely on it to prepare installation media for various Linux distributions by transferring system images block by block to USB drives or SD cards.

The utility operates primarily within Linux environments, adhering to the MIT license terms. It interacts directly with block devices, which typically requires administrative privileges during execution to ensure proper write access to the target media. While limited in scope compared to multi-platform imaging suites, Nixwriter serves as a dedicated tool for users who need to generate bootable installation media directly from a Linux desktop without navigating complex configuration menus.
